What is Google I/O 2023?

Google I/O is an annual developer conference organized by Google. It showcases the company’s latest products, software, updates, and other innovations. In fact, that is what “I/O” means. The full form of Google I/O is Input/Output and the tagline is “Open Innovation.”

Google I/O is similar to another major event, Google Developer Day, and is an opportunity for the tech giant to showcase its latest products and solutions, announce new product launches as well like introducing software updates and other tools for developers. Users are especially looking forward to Pixel Fold. The conference also includes keynotes from top Google executives, technical sessions, and Q&A sessions. When does Google I/O 2023 take place?

Google I/O 2023 will be held on May 10, 2023 at 10 a.m. PST. The event will be broadcast globally and is free for everyone to attend online. But only a limited number of spectators will be present in person at the venue. Google I/O 2023 will take place at the Shoreline Amphitheater in Mountain View, California.

Viewers will be able to live stream speaker keynotes, check out technical content, and access learning materials.

How to watch Google I/O 2023? Tickets and registration

There are no tickets available for Google I/O this year, and people can register online to watch the conference. Visit the official Google I/O site to sign up with your Google account. This event is open to everyone. You can also create a developer profile to get recommendations and content updates according to your preferences.
